Modern MediaTek devices protect their memory partitions using secure boot mechanisms that require a signed Download Agent (DA) file. MTK Client Tool V55 includes a built-in exploit mechanism that bypasses SLA (Secure Boot Enforcement) and DAA (Download Agent Authentication), allowing direct connection without official brand credentials. The MTK Client Tool is not a simple flashing utility. It works at the and download agent (DA) levels, allowing direct chip‑level access even when the device’s operating system is completely dead. Below are its standout features.
